Challenge unconscious bias from "summary" of Building an Inclusive Organization by Stephen Frost,Raafi-Karim Alidina
Unconscious bias is a deeply ingrained part of human behavior. It affects our perceptions, judgments, and decisions in ways that we may not even be aware of. These biases can lead to unfair treatment of certain groups of people, which in turn can perpetuate inequality and hinder diversity and inclusion efforts in organizations. To address unconscious bias, it is crucial to first acknowledge its existence and understand how it manifests in our thoughts and actions. This requires individuals to be introspective and willing to confront their own biases, even if it may be uncomfortable or challenging. By recognizing and accepting our biases, we can begin to take steps to challenge and counteract them. One effective way to challenge unconscious bias is through education and awareness-raising. This can involve training programs, workshops, and discussions that help individuals recognize and understand their biases, as well as the impact they have on others.
